October 29, 2021: SOAP #4348:  Job 20; Mark 3-4

SCRIPTURE:  Mark (NIV) 2:1 Another time he went into the synagogue, and a man with a shriveled hand was there. 2 Some of them were looking for a reason to accuse Jesus, so they watched him closely to see if he would heal him on the Sabbath. 3 Jesus said to the man with the shriveled hand, “Stand up in front of everyone.” 4 Then Jesus asked them, “Which is lawful on the Sabbath: to do good or to do evil, to save life or to kill?” But they remained silent. 5 He looked round at them in anger and deeply distressed at their stubborn hearts, said to the man, “Stretch out your hand.” He stretched it out, and his hand was completely restored. 6 Then the Pharisees went out and began to plot with the Herodians how they might kill Jesus.

OBSERVATION:  The Pharisees had a reason to keep a close eye on Jesus.  They watched him closely with a purpose.  They were looking for a reason to accuse Him.  They knew Jesus healed many people; could they catch him doing it on the Sabbath? 

APPLICATION:  I want to be one who closely watches Jesus at work in the world around me.  I want to be quick to recognize His hand at work.  I want to be watching with a heart of love.  I want to be quick to rejoice and give Him praise when I see Him working in someone’s life.  Sometimes He may even let me have a small part in what He is doing!  

Also, I want to look for opportunities to encourage and appreciate people rather than accuse them.  I want to catch people doing something good, rather than something wrong.

PRAYER: Holy Spirit, help me keep my eyes on Jesus.  Especially bring to my attention the many things Jesus is doing in the lives of those around me.  Amen.
